Course Content

• Gender and Environmental Justice: Intersections and Frameworks
• Climate Change Impacts and Gendered Vulnerability (Climate Justice, Gender Equity)
• Environmental Policy Analysis through a Gender Lens
• Gender-Responsive Environmental Management and Governance
• Women's Rights, Environmental Rights, and International Law
• Indigenous Women and Environmental Stewardship
• Sustainable Development Goals and Gender Equality in Environmental Policy
• Advocacy and Activism for Gender Justice in Environmental Policy (Policy advocacy, grassroots movements)

Career path

Career Role (Gender Justice & Environmental Policy) Description
Environmental Policy Analyst (Gender Focus) Analyze environmental policies for gender-based impacts; advocate for inclusive solutions. High demand.
Sustainability Consultant (Gender Equality) Advise organizations on integrating gender justice into sustainability strategies. Growing job market.
Community Engagement Officer (Environmental Justice) Engage marginalized communities in environmental decision-making, promoting gender equality. Strong need for skills.
Researcher (Gender & Climate Change) Investigate the intersection of gender and climate change; contribute to evidence-based policy. Excellent career prospects.
